Tracie Ramsdale – Alchemia Ltd (acl.asx)

TRACIE RAMSDALE is one of the founders of Alchemia Limited and has led the company's development as its General Manager and Chief Executive Officer. Tracie joined the Board of Directors in July 2003. Since Alchemia's inception, she has been responsible for raising over $26 million in venture capital funding, negotiating Alchemia's alliances with Dow and APP, and recruiting Alchemia's senior management team. Dr. Ramsdale led the company through its successful initial public offering in December 2003. She was originally trained as a synthetic organic chemist, obtaining a Master of Pharmacy degree from the Victorian College of Pharmacy and a PhD in Biochemistry from the University of Queensland. She has extensive experience in research management and technology commercialization. Before establishing Alchemia, she was a Principal Investigator and Commercial Manager of the Centre for Drug Design and Development at the University of Queensland (Institute for Molecular Bioscience). Prior to this, she held research appointments at the Victorian College of Pharmacy and Bond University. She is a member of the Australian Institute of Company Directors and serves on the Queensland Biotechnology Advisory Council and the federal government's IR&D Board's Biological Committee. Profile
